Discover the timeless beauty of handcrafted brass art from Betul district, created using the ancient lost wax casting technique, widely known as Dhokra. In Madhya Pradesh, this traditional craft is also called Bharewa, named after the artisan community that has preserved it for generations. The Bharewa artisans have been practicing this heritage craft for centuries, originally creating ceremonial and cultural pieces for the Gond tribal community—one of the largest tribal communities in central India. Today, their craftsmanship continues to reflect deep cultural roots, authenticity, and intricate detailing. What makes Bharewa brass craft unique is its sustainable and eco-friendly process. Artisans upcycle discarded brass materials, such as broken utensils sourced from local markets, and combine them with natural beeswax collected from forest regions. Through a meticulous handmade process, these raw materials are transformed into stunning home décor, tribal art, and collectible pieces.
